Brooke Shields Biography

Birth Name:Brooke Shields

Birth Place:New York City, New York, United States

Profession Actress, Producer, Soundtrack

Fast Facts

  • Has served as a spokesperson for Tupperware's Chain of Confidence SMART Girls campaign to advocate for the empowerment of women
  • In 1980, she became the youngest model to appear on the cover of Vogue magazine at 14 years old
  • Started modeling at 11 months old when she landed a job in an Ivory soap advertisement
  • Quote: "Don't waste a minute not being happy․ If one window closes, run to the next window - or break down a door․"
  • Quote: "Honesty is the quality I value most in a friend․ Not bluntness, but honesty with compassion․"
  • Turned down a lead role in the film "Scarface․"
  • Appeared in "Annie Hall," but her scenes were cut from the finished film
  • Is a distant relative of fellow actress Glenn Close
